Intervención terapéutica farmacológica del deterioro cognitivo leve

Revista Española de Geriatría y Gerontología, 2017
Mild cognitive impairment (MCI) is a syndrome encompassing affective and behavioural symptoms and various subtypes. MCI is a heterogeneous clinical entity with varied causes (degenerative, vascular, psychiatric, non-neurological disorders), and there is wide variation in symptoms and clinical course.
